Antón Martín (Madrid Metro)
Antón Martín [anˈtom maɾˈtin] is a station on Line 1 of the Madrid Metro.[1] It is located in Fare Zone A and has been open to the public since 26 December 1921.[2] The station is named for Antón Martín (1500–1553) of the Knights Hospitaller, who founded the nearby Hospital de San Juan de Dios.[3]
